Laravel Herd

macOS 文档

Meilisearch

#
为 Laravel Scout 设置 Meilisearch

Meilisearch 是一个功能强大的搜索引擎,适用于您的应用程序,与 Laravel Scout 完美配合。它允许您通过简单地将 Searchable Trait 添加到模型来为您的应用程序添加一个具有极高相关性、拼写纠正等功能的搜索引擎。

Screenshot of Meilisearch settings

#
配置

与所有 Herd 服务一样,您可以配置端口以及 Meilisearch 实例的服务名称,并将以下环境变量添加到您的 .env 文件中。

SCOUT_DRIVER=meilisearch
MEILISEARCH_HOST=http://127.0.0.1:7700
MEILISEARCH_KEY=LARAVEL-HERD

使用 Meilisearch 驱动程序时,您需要通过 Composer 包管理器安装 Meilisearch PHP SDK

composer require meilisearch/meilisearch-php http-interop/http-factory-guzzle

您可以在 Laravel 文档 中找到有关将 Laravel Scout 与 Meilisearch 一起使用的更多信息。

#
仪表盘

您可以通过 http://locahost:port 或使用服务列表中的仪表盘按钮访问 Meilisearch 仪表盘。

Screenshot of the Meilisearch dashboard